John 13:1And before the feast of the passover, Jesus knowing that his hour hath come, that he may remove out of this world unto the Father, having loved his own who [are] in the world to the end he loved them.Now before the feast of the passover, Jesus, knowing that his hour had come that he should depart out of this world to the Father, having loved his own who were in the world, loved them to the end.Now before the feast of the Passover, Jesus knowing that his time had come that he would depart out of this world to his Father, having loved his own who were in the world, he loved them to the end.
John 13:2And supper being come, the devil already having put [it] into the heart of Judas of Simon, Iscariot, that he may deliver him up,And during supper, the devil having already put it into the heart of Judas [son] of Simon, Iscariote, that he should deliver him up,After supper, the devil having already put into the heart of Judas Iscariot, Simon's son, to betray him,
John 13:3Jesus knowing that all things the Father hath given to him into [his] hands, and that from God he came forth, and unto God he goeth,[Jesus,] knowing that the Father had given him all things into his hands, and that he came out from God and was going to God,Jesus, knowing that the Father had given all things into his hands, and that he came forth from God, and was going to God,
John 13:4doth rise from the supper, and doth lay down his garments, and having taken a towel, he girded himself;rises from supper and lays aside his garments, and having taken a linen towel he girded himself:arose from supper, and laid aside his outer garments. He took a towel, and wrapped a towel around his waist.
John 13:5afterward he putteth water into the basin, and began to wash the feet of his disciples, and to wipe with the towel with which he was being girded.then he pours water into the washhand basin, and began to wash the feet of the disciples, and to wipe them with the linen towel with which he was girded.Then he poured water into the basin, and began to wash the disciples' feet, and to wipe them with the towel that was wrapped around him.
John 13:6He cometh, therefore, unto Simon Peter, and that one saith to him, `Sir, thou dost thou wash my feet?`He comes therefore to Simon Peter; and *he* says to him, Lord, dost thou wash *my* feet?Then he came to Simon Peter. He said to him, "Lord, do you wash my feet?"
John 13:7Jesus answered and said to him, `That which I do thou hast not known now, but thou shalt know after these things;`Jesus answered and said to him, What I do thou dost not know now, but thou shalt know hereafter.Jesus answered him, "You don't know what I am doing now, but you will understand later."
John 13:8Peter saith to him, `Thou mayest not wash my feet to the age.` Jesus answered him, `If I may not wash thee, thou hast no part with me;`Peter says to him, Thou shalt never wash my feet. Jesus answered him, Unless I wash thee, thou hast not part with me.Peter said to him, "You will never wash my feet!" Jesus answered him, "If I don't wash you, you have no part with me."
John 13:9Simon Peter saith to him, `Sir, not my feet only, but also the hands and the head.`Simon Peter says to him, Lord, not my feet only, but also my hands and my head.Simon Peter said to him, "Lord, not my feet only, but also my hands and my head!"
John 13:10Jesus saith to him, `He who hath been bathed hath no need save to wash his feet, but he is clean altogether; and ye are clean, but not all;`Jesus says to him, He that is washed all over needs not to wash save his feet, but is wholly clean; and ye are clean, but not all.Jesus said to him, "Someone who has bathed only needs to have their feet washed, but is completely clean. You are clean, but not all of you."
John 13:11for he knew him who is delivering him up; because of this he said, `Ye are not all clean.`For he knew him that delivered him up: on account of this he said, Ye are not all clean.For he knew him who would betray him, therefore he said, "You are not all clean."
John 13:12When, therefore, he washed their feet, and took his garments, having reclined (at meat) again, he said to them, `Do ye know what I have done to you?When therefore he had washed their feet, and taken his garments, having sat down again, he said to them, Do ye know what I have done to you?So when he had washed their feet, put his outer garment back on, and sat down again, he said to them, "Do you know what I have done to you?
John 13:13ye call me, The Teacher and The Lord, and ye say well, for I am;Ye call me the Teacher and the Lord, and ye say well, for I am [so].You call me, 'Teacher' and 'Lord.' You say so correctly, for so I am.
John 13:14if then I did wash your feet the Lord and the Teacher ye also ought to wash one another`s feet.If I therefore, the Lord and the Teacher, have washed your feet, ye also ought to wash one another's feet;If I then, the Lord and the Teacher, have washed your feet, you also ought to wash one another's feet.
John 13:15`For an example I gave to you, that, according as I did to you, ye also may do;for I have given you an example that, as I have done to you, ye should do also.For I have given you an example, that you also should do as I have done to you.
John 13:16verily, verily, I say to you, a servant is not greater than his lord, nor an apostle greater than he who sent him;Verily, verily, I say to you, The bondman is not greater than his lord, nor the sent greater than he who has sent him.Most assuredly I tell you, a servant is not greater than his lord, neither one who is sent greater than he who sent him.
John 13:17if these things ye have known, happy are ye, if ye may do them;If ye know these things, blessed are ye if ye do them.If you know these things, blessed are you if you do them.
John 13:18not concerning you all do I speak; I have known whom I chose for myself; but that the Writing may be fulfilled: He who is eating the bread with me, did lift up against me his heel.I speak not of you all. I know those whom I have chosen; but that the scripture might be fulfilled, He that eats bread with me has lifted up his heel against me.I speak not of you all. I know whom I have chosen. But that the scripture may be fulfilled, 'He who eats bread with me has lifted up his heel against me.'
John 13:19`From this time I tell you, before its coming to pass, that, when it may come to pass, ye may believe that I am [he];I tell you [it] now before it happens, that when it happens, ye may believe that I am [he].From now on, I tell you before it happens, that when it happens, you may believe that I AM.
John 13:20verily, verily, I say to you, he who is receiving whomsoever I may send, doth receive me; and he who is receiving me, doth receive Him who sent me.`Verily, verily, I say to you, He who receives whomsoever I shall send receives me; and he that receives me receives him who has sent me.Most assuredly I tell you, he who receives whoever I send, receives me; and he who receives me, receives him who sent me."
John 13:21These things having said, Jesus was troubled in the spirit, and did testify, and said, `Verily, verily, I say to you, that one of you will deliver me up;`Having said these things, Jesus was troubled in spirit, and testified and said, Verily, verily, I say to you, that one of you shall deliver me up.When Jesus had said this, he was troubled in the spirit, and testified, "Most assuredly I tell you that one of you will betray me."
John 13:22the disciples were looking, therefore, one at another, doubting concerning whom he speaketh.The disciples therefore looked one on another, doubting of whom he spoke.The disciples looked at one another, perplexed about whom he spoke.
John 13:23And there was one of his disciples reclining (at meat) in the bosom of Jesus, whom Jesus was loving;Now there was at table one of his disciples in the bosom of Jesus, whom Jesus loved.One of his disciples, whom Jesus loved, was at the table, leaning against Jesus' breast.
John 13:24Simon Peter, then, doth beckon to this one, to inquire who he may be concerning whom he speaketh,Simon Peter makes a sign therefore to him to ask who it might be of whom he spoke.Simon Peter therefore beckoned to him, and said to him, "Tell us who it is of whom he speaks."
John 13:25and that one having leant back on the breast of Jesus, respondeth to him, `Sir, who is it?`But he, leaning on the breast of Jesus, says to him, Lord, who is it?He, leaning back, as he was, on Jesus' breast, asked him, "Lord, who is it?"
John 13:26Jesus answereth, `That one it is to whom I, having dipped the morsel, shall give it;` and having dipped the morsel, he giveth [it] to Judas of Simon, Iscariot.Jesus answers, He it is to whom I, after I have dipped the morsel, give it. And having dipped the morsel, he gives it to Judas [son] of Simon, Iscariote.Jesus therefore answered, "It is he who I will give this morsel to when I have dipped it." So when he had dipped the morsel, he gave it to Judas, the son of Simon Iscariot.
John 13:27And after the morsel, then the Adversary entered into that one, Jesus, therefore, saith to him, `What thou dost do quickly;`And, after the morsel, then entered Satan into him. Jesus therefore says to him, What thou doest, do quickly.After the morsel, then Satan entered into him. Jesus therefore said to him, "What you do, do quickly."
John 13:28and none of those reclining at meat knew for what intent he said this to him,But none of those at table knew why he said this to him;Now no man at the table knew why he said this to him.
John 13:29for certain were thinking, since Judas had the bag, that Jesus saith to him, `Buy what we have need of for the feast;` or that he may give something to the poor;for some supposed, because Judas had the bag, that Jesus was saying to him, Buy the things of which we have need for the feast; or that he should give something to the poor.For some thought, because Judas had the money box, that Jesus said to him, "Buy what things we need for the feast," or that he should give something to the poor.
John 13:30having received, therefore, the morsel, that one immediately went forth, and it was night.Having therefore received the morsel, he went out immediately; and it was night.Therefore, having received that morsel, he went out immediately. It was night.
John 13:31When, therefore, he went forth, Jesus saith, `Now was the Son of Man glorified, and God was glorified in him;When therefore he was gone out Jesus says, Now is the Son of man glorified, and God is glorified in him.When he had gone out, Jesus said, "Now the Son of Man is glorified, and God is glorified in him.
John 13:32if God was glorified in him, God also will glorify him in Himself; yea, immediately He will glorify him.If God be glorified in him, God also shall glorify him in himself, and shall glorify him immediately.If God is glorified in him, God will also glorify him in himself, and he will glorify him immediately.
John 13:33`Little children, yet a little am I with you; ye will seek me, and, according as I said to the Jews Whither I go away, ye are not able to come, to you also I do say [it] now.Children, yet a little while I am with you. Ye shall seek me; and, as I said to the Jews, Where I go ye cannot come, I say to you also now.Little children, yet a little while I am with you. You will seek me, and as I said to the Jews, 'Where I am going, you can't come,' so now I tell you.
John 13:34`A new commandment I give to you, that ye love one another; according as I did love you, that ye also love one another;A new commandment I give to you, that ye love one another; as I have loved you, that ye also love one another.A new commandment I give to you, that you love one another, just like I have loved you; that you also love one another.
John 13:35in this shall all know that ye are my disciples, if ye may have love one to another.`By this shall all know that ye are disciples of mine, if ye have love amongst yourselves.By this everyone will know that you are my disciples, if you have love for one another."
John 13:36Simon Peter saith to him, `Sir, whither dost thou go away?` Jesus answered him, `Whither I go away, thou art not able now to follow me, but afterward thou shalt follow me.`Simon Peter says to him, Lord, where goest thou? Jesus answered him, Where I go thou canst not follow me now, but thou shalt follow me after.Simon Peter said to him, "Lord, where are you going?" Jesus answered, "Where I am going, you can't follow now, but you will follow afterwards."
John 13:37Peter saith to him, `Sir, wherefore am I not able to follow thee now? my life for thee I will lay down;`Peter says to him, Lord, why cannot I follow thee now? I will lay down my life for thee.Peter said to him, "Lord, why can't I follow you even now? I will lay down my life for you."
John 13:38Jesus answered him, `Thy life for me thou wilt lay down! verily, verily, I say to thee, a cock will not crow till thou mayest deny me thrice.`Jesus answers, Thou wilt lay down thy life for me! Verily, verily, I say to thee, The cock shall not crow till thou hast denied me thrice.Jesus answered him, "Will you lay down your life for me? Most assuredly I tell you, the rooster won't crow until you have denied me three times.
